Turkish companies towards Second Life

It sound a little bit odd, but Turkey has companies which, in 2008, will heavily invest in Second Life.
Vestel will soon be followed by Remax, Rixos and others.
This is a sign that the interest in Second Life is still rising… But beware: trends show that, after the initial rush to virtual worlds, companies face the reality and start thinking where their money are going.
I really hope that turkish companies will start with the right foot, understanding past mistakes and acting accordingly.

Second Life and Facebook

Second Life and Facebook

The always great Giulio Prisco writes about Facebook, as a 2D social backend for Second Life.
I think this is an interesting argument: Second Life, despite is much about “social”, still lacks a good interface to socialize in the real life.
One main reason is the DIFFERENCE between Avatars and Real Life persons. In Facebook, instead, you have YOUR pictures.
Another main reason is that Second Life is still difficult to use. Facebook is not.
I suppose Linden Lab will address those missing parts during 2008.
